What is the per-package limit for UN3480 P.I.965 Lithium Ion Batteries when shipped under 1A packaging?

Explanation:
The per-package limit for UN3480 lithium ion batteries shipped under 1A packaging is 35 kg. This weight cap is set by the packaging instruction to keep individual shipments manageable and reduce the risk of damage or thermal events during air transport. The weight counted includes the battery plus its protective packaging inside the outer container. If your shipment would exceed 35 kg, split it into multiple packages so each stays at or below 35 kg, and follow the other packaging and labeling requirements. The other weight options aren’t the standard limit for this scenario; 35 kg is the maximum allowed per package under 1A packaging for UN3480.
